FIVE KINGDOM CLASSIFICATION
ROBERT.H.WHITAKER
He classified all living organisms into five distinct Kingdom., based on the no: of cells and mode of nutrition.
KINGDOM MONERAFIRST KINGDOM
MONERA
a.One celled organism or unicellular organism
b.No nucleusc.Prokaryoticd.Smallest and simplest
kind of living beinge.Members include
Bacteria.

SECOND KINGDOM
KINGDOM PROTISTA
FEATURES:
Most Protists are single celled but some have many cells
The cells have a membrane around the nucleus
Some protists get nutrients and energy by eating other organisms
Some protists get energy from the sun and nutrients from the water
Most protist reproduce by splitting into two

KINGDOM FUNGITHIRD KINGDOM
CHARACTERISTICS
Most fungi are many celled and some are one celled organisms
Eukaryotic Cells of the fungi have a
membrane around nucleus The fungi gets energy and
nutrients by absorbing and digesting from the surface they live on
Most fungi reproduce by spores
KINGDOM PLANTAEFOURTH KINGDOM
CHARACTERISICS Plants are many celled
organisms Plants cells have
membrane around the nucleus, contain chlorophyll and have cell walls
Plants get energy from the un and nutrients from their surroundings
Most plants reproduce from the seeds
KINGDOM ANIMALIA
FIFTH KINGDOM
CHARACTERISTICS Animals are many celled or
multi cellular organisms Heterotrophic organisms Animals cell have a membrane
around the nucleus Animals get energy and
nutrients by eating other organisms
Animals reproduce with eggs, some inside the mother’s body , some outside the mother’s body
